Carthage Press, The (MO)
January 15, 2014
Bert Walter Nichols, Sr., 87, Carthage, passed away Sunday, Jan. 12, 2014 at his home with family members at his bedside.
Bert Walter Nichols, Sr. was born April 2, 1926 in Mercedes, Texas; a son of the late Bert Emory Nichols and Effie May (Banks) Nichols.
Bert was a U.S. Marine veteran serving during WWII in the Pacific theater.
He married Naomi Eve Card on June 28, 1946 in the Emanual Baptist Church, southeast of Carthage; she survives.
Bert owned and operated Bert's Garage and Wrecker Service, Carthage, for many years. He and his wife, Dr. Naomi Nichols were members of the First Baptist Church, Carthage. He was a member of the Carthage VFW, Carthage American Legion, the Carthage Masonic Lodge and the Carthage Shriners.
Additional survivors include, three sons; Bert Walter Nichols, Jr., Carthage, Harold Homer Nichols, wife, Hazel, Carthage and Charles Taylor Nichols, wife, Alisha, Sarcoxie, Mo.; four daughters; Alta May Smith, husband, Garrett, Carthage, Patricia Ann McClure, husband, Gene, Caney, Kan., Ruth Andrea West, husband, John, Carthage and Nancy Irene Rinehart, husband, Mark, Atlanta, Texas; one brother, Frank Homer Nichols, wife, Mae, LaRussell, Mo., and one sister, Emma Mary Straw, husband, Bud, Stotts City, Mo.; 24 grandchildren, 42 great-grandchildren and 13 great-grandchildren.
Bert was preceded in death by a brother, Lawrence Nichols, a grandson, Richard Emory Smith and a daughter-in-law, Johanna Marie (Atkinson) Nichols.
